Animal Physiology
A program that focuses on the scientific study of function, morphology, regulation, and intercellular communications and dynamics within vertebrate and invertebrate in animal species, with comparative applications to homo sapiens and its relatives and antecedents. Includes instruction in reproduction, growth, lactation, digestion, performance, behavioral adaptation, sensory perception, motor action, phylogenetics, biotic and abiotic function, membrane biology, and related aspects of biochemistry and biophysics.

Where this major leads
Occupations most often associated with this major, from the federal BLS+O*NET crosswalk. Job-growth projections and median wages are national.
| Occupation | Median wage | Job growth | Typical education |
|---|---|---|---|
| Natural sciences managers | $161k | +3.7% | Bachelor's degree |
| Biological science teachers, postsecondary | $83k | +7.3% | Doctoral or professional degree |
| Biological scientists, all other | $93k | +1.2% | Bachelor's degree |
| Zoologists and wildlife biologists | $73k | +1.6% | Bachelor's degree |
